When Should I Start Taking Baby Bump Pictures?

So, you’re expecting a little bundle of joy and you want to capture every moment of your pregnancy journey, including that adorable baby bump. One of the questions that often arises for expecting mothers is when is the best time to start taking those precious baby bump pictures?

Experts suggest that the ideal time to start capturing your baby bump is usually between 28 to 36 weeks into your pregnancy. This timeframe allows your belly to have that round, prominent shape without being too close to your delivery date.

During the 28-36 week period, most women feel comfortable enough to still move around easily and pose for those beautiful belly shots. It’s a time when your bump is at its fullest, making for some stunning photographic moments to cherish forever.

However, it’s important to remember that there are no strict rules about when to start taking baby bump pictures. Pregnancy is a unique journey for each woman, and the right time to start capturing your bump is ultimately a personal choice.

Sometimes, mothers-to-be may feel the urge to start documenting their baby bump earlier on in the pregnancy. If you’re feeling excited and want to capture the growth of your bump from the very beginning, there’s no harm in starting early and creating a beautiful timeline of your pregnancy.

On the flip side, some women may prefer to wait until later in the third trimester when their belly has fully blossomed. Waiting until closer to the due date can also add a sense of anticipation and the imminent arrival of your little one to the photo series.

It’s also worth considering the seasonal aspects when deciding when to start taking baby bump pictures. If you have a specific preference for capturing your bump in a particular season, you may want to plan your photo sessions accordingly.

Another factor to keep in mind is how you’re feeling physically and emotionally during your pregnancy. If you’re experiencing discomfort or fatigue in the later stages, you may want to take your baby bump pictures earlier when you’re feeling more energetic and at ease.

Some expecting mothers choose to have a series of bump photos taken at different stages of their pregnancy to capture the gradual growth and changes. This can create a beautiful narrative of the journey from conception to the arrival of your little one.

Ultimately, the decision on when to start taking baby bump pictures boils down to what feels right for you. Whether you choose to start early, wait until later in the pregnancy, or have a series of bump photos, the most important thing is to capture these special moments in a way that brings you joy and allows you to look back on this magical time in your life.
